This large (sorry) commit
1. switches from a composable plugin model to a single-plugin model 2. switches class methods to static methods in the BaseConsensusRules class 3. adds create_transaction, sign_transaction, and verify_transaction to the plugin API TODO: If we adopt this model, all references in e.g. client.py to util methods like `sign_tx` need to be routed through the plugin methods, and possibly need to be added to the plugin interface.
